New Polycom Immersive Telepresence Service Program Ensures World-Class Service From Certified Partners


(Market Wire Via Acquire Media NewsEdge) PLEASANTON, CA -- (MARKET WIRE) -- 10/22/09 -- Polycom, Inc. (NASDAQ: PLCM), the global leader in telepresence, video and voice communication solutions, today announced a new certification program for partners that offer managed network services, also known as Video Network Operations Center (VNOC) services, for Polycom immersive telepresence solutions. The Polycom Immersive Telepresence VNOC Service Provider Certification Program features the industry's most stringent requirements to ensure quality and reliability of services and the best user experience for customers.



The program features both "Certified" and "Advanced Certified" requirements. The "Certified" program provides partners with the knowledge and capabilities to deliver and support immersive telepresence VNOC service offerings. Certified TVP partners must attend intensive VNOC technical and best practice training, as well as meet lab and training requirements.

Polycom "Advanced Certified" partners must also complete advanced lab and training requirements, adhere to program governance and complete operational audits supported by Polycom.


Polycom reseller partners BT and Nortel have achieved Polycom's highest certifications for telepresence service and reseller status with Polycom Advanced Certified Immersive Telepresence VNOC Service Provider status, and Polycom Telepresence Certified Plus reseller status. Polycom reseller partner AVI-SPL has achieved Polycom Advanced Certified Immersive Telepresence VNOC Service Provider status, and Polycom Telepresence Certified reseller status.

In addition, Polycom VNOC delivery partners Glowpoint and Iformata Communications have also achieved Polycom Advanced Certified Immersive Telepresence VNOC Service Provider status.

The program ensures customers that certified channel and delivery partners have completed rigorous product training; have the expertise and capabilities for troubleshooting, testing, upgrade and update verification; have tighter integration with Polycom Global Services; have coordinated access to Polycom engineering teams in support of VNOC service delivery; have completed a complete process audit, ensuring compliance with all Polycom-defined standards; and utilize proven and detailed Polycom standard operational processes in support of Polycom immersive telepresence solutions and VNOC services.

Polycom Immersive Telepresence VNOC Service Provider partners also receive early access to new products and product enhancements to ensure seamless support as new products and capabilities come to market.

About Polycom Telepresence -- Polycom telepresence provides a natural, high-definition visual communication experience that allows people to collaborate more effectively across distances.

-- Polycom telepresence solutions are based on established video conferencing standards and interoperate natively with more than two-million video conferencing and telepresence systems in use today.

-- Polycom offers the broadest range of fully interoperable telepresence solutions to meet customers' varying application, space and budget requirements. Polycom solutions can be deployed within any unified communications (UC) environment and feature integration with leading UC platforms from Microsoft, IBM, Avaya, Nortel, BroadSoft and others.

-- Polycom is the industry leader in telepresence, having shipped more than 50,000 telepresence solutions through Q2 2009. Polycom has leading market share for the total installed video communication market (41 percent) and leading market share for units shipped for the first half of 2009 (35 percent) (Wainhouse Research, Sept. 2009).

-- Polycom telepresence customers include industry leaders in business, entertainment, education, financial services, healthcare and government.

Examples include: Turner Broadcasting Systems, Georgetown University, NASDAQ, Duke University, Amgen, NATO, Atari, Massachusetts General, Regus, Zurich Financial, National Defense University, Oklahoma Army National Guard, and Defense Acquisition University.
